Did you find an inaccuracy? Help us keep the map up to date - Edit
120 GRISTMIL PLAZA, WILLIAMSBURG, VA, 23185, Williamsburg, United States
12551 Jefferson Ave Ste 165 Newport News, VA 23602, Newport News, United States
12300 JEFFERSON AVE SUITE 700, NEWPORT NEWS, VA, 23602, Newport News, United States
119-A Village Avenue, Virginia, Yorktown, 23693, Yorktown, United States
12080 Jefferson Avenue, Suite 905, Newport News, VA 23606, Newport News, United States
12480 B WARWICK BLVD---NEWPORT NEWS-USA, Newport News, United States
Reviews on Patriot Tours & Provisions
Don't drive past! This point needs your opinion.